What is Chain.io?

Chain.io
SoftwareSupply Chain Management (SCM) Software

Chain.io operates as a specialized connectivity platform designed to streamline data integration for the logistics and supply chain sectors. By providing a fully managed integration service, the company enables Logistics Service Providers, Shippers, and Technology Firms to harmonize their operations under a unified digital umbrella. The platform is particularly noted for its ability to bridge the technical divide between modern APIs and legacy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) systems, effectively solving the persistent challenge of data silos in global trade.

How much funding has Chain.io raised?

Chain.io has raised a total of $16.1M across 3 funding rounds:

2020

Debt

$150K

2021

Unspecified

$5M

2022

Series A

$11M

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P

Unspecified (2021): $5M led by Engage, Grand Ventures, Mercury, and Honeywell Ventures

Series A (2022): $11M supported by Fontinalis Partners, Grand Ventures, Mercury, and High Alpha
